Security
When it comes to security, Mercedes spare keys take things a step beyond the typical automobile. Instead of a simple transponder device, which sends an encrypted code to the car through a radio, Mercedes key fobs use infrared signals to transmit an encrypted code to the vehicle. This means that the signal is much more difficult to spot, and it's much less likely to be picked up by thieves.
There are additional safety measures taken by mercedes spare keys as well. First of all, they're made to be programmed once with the chassis number of your car together with other security codes that are unique to you. This means that no one could copy your mercedes key programing key and start the car.
Additionally, there's the Mercedes Electronic Ignition Switch which runs a series of complex electronic tests to be sure that it's the right key for your car. It is extremely difficult for even the most skilled thieves to break your Mercedes' safety features.
